CM15 8JT lies on York Road in Shenfield, Brentwood. CM15 8JT is located in the Shenfield electoral ward, within the local authority district of Brentwood and the English Parliamentary constituency of Brentwood and Ongar.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Mid and South Essex ICB - 99E and the police force is Essex.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
